Alex’s career began when he joined the United States Marine Corps, where he quickly advanced to the rank of non-commissioned officer. He participated in several operations in Al Anbar Province, Iraq, supporting high-risk convoy security missions. He also assumed supervisory duties, ensuring the readiness and safety of his team. This service became the foundation for his leadership, allowing him to travel and gain a broad perspective.
One of his notable assignments was a Permanent Duty Station in Okinawa, Japan, where he supervised more than 30 service members. His responsibilities included overseeing physical training and inspecting military engineering gear, ensuring his team's welfare and safety. His leadership and service earned him multiple personal awards, recognizing his commitment and effectiveness in challenging environments.
After completing his military service, Alex transitioned to the public sector as an employee with the Social Security Administration. In this role, he conducted investigative interviews, determined benefit eligibility, and navigated complex regulatory criteria. Fluent in both English and Spanish, he communicated effectively with individuals from diverse backgrounds, ensuring fair and accurate treatment for all.
In addition to his routine responsibilities, he made significant decisions regarding congressional inquiries and overpayment recovery efforts. He reviewed financial data, collaborated with attorneys, and issued decisions directly impacting people’s lives. His analytical skills and unwavering dedication to public service were consistently at the forefront of his work.
Alexander Karman also worked in claims analysis, Medicare, and other federal benefit programs. His focus on fraud prevention, debt recovery, and compliance highlighted his integrity in interpreting policies accurately while prioritizing the public’s best interests.
Alex transitioned to the private sector, applying his leadership skills in the insurance industry. He began as the Director of Sales at one of the largest insurance brokerages in South Florida. His first goal was to streamline communication and operational platforms within the company, improving the information flow between sales agents, internal teams, and corporate executives. This initiative helped enhance operational efficiency and communication.
His success in this role led to his promotion to Director of Broker Support and Licensing, where he ensured agents maintained the necessary health insurance licenses and adhered to CMS and state DOI policies. Alex focused on maintaining operational compliance in this position while fostering growth and efficiency.
As Director of Broker Support and Licensing, Alex's leadership style emphasized mentorship and team development. He fought for salary increases and advancement opportunities for his employees, ensuring everyone under his leadership felt valued for their contributions. His management approach aimed at creating a culture of accountability and teamwork, prioritizing the team's success over individual accolades.
